RF exposure
This transmitter with its antenna is designed to comply
with FCC / IC RF exposure limits for general population
/ uncontrolled exposure. The WiFi / Bluetooth antenna
is mounted behind the front facia on the left hand side
of the screen. It is recommended to maintain a safe
distance of at least 1 cm from the left hand side of the
screen.

Suppression ferrites
Raymarine cables may be fitted with suppression
ferrites. These are important for correct EMC
performance. If a ferrite has to be removed for any
purpose (e.g. installation or maintenance), it must be
replaced in the original position before the product is
used.
Use only ferrites of the correct type, supplied by
Raymarine authorized dealers.
Where an installation requires multiple ferrites to be
added to a cable, additional cable clips should be used
to prevent stress on the connectors due to the extra
weight of the cable.
